This week, Year 3 took part in an exciting democratic decision, voting for our new Junior Leadership Team.

Over half the class wrote and presented fantastic speeches, sharing their brilliant ideas for making our school even better. Some spoke about helping the environment, others suggested more after-school clubs and many had thoughtful ideas about how to make school life happier for everyone.

We even used a voting ballot, just like in a real election. Every child had the chance to vote fairly and respectfully, showing great maturity and kindness when listening to different views.

It was wonderful to see everyone take part so enthusiastically — what a fantastic example of our British Value of Democracy in action!

Congratulations to Kupa and Harry, our new Year 3 representatives, and best of luck from all your friends in Year 3!
